Transporting temperature-sensitive Pharma products Requires tested thermal shippers, Appropriate refrigerants, and unbroken temperature monitoring. Specify an express service where possible, pre-cool gel packs, and place a data logger in the carton to verify that medical drugs stayed within their labeled temperature range.
Fragile glass vials of pharmaceutical goods Should be packed in Molded trays with 360-degree padding. Place trays inside a double-walled box and stabilize using void-fill so nothing moves. For moisture-sensitive medical drugs, pair this with moisture-barrier inner bags and desiccants.
International shipments of medical drugs typically Require a detailed commercial invoice, packing list, and any Licenses required by the importing country. Most regulated markets also Expect Certificates of Analysis, proof of GDP-compliant handling, and clear temperature instructions for cold-chain medicines. Double-check requirements with your customs broker before shipping.
For moisture-sensitive pharmaceutical goods, Use Foil-laminate pouches plus desiccant sachets inside the packaging. Secure cartons tightly, avoid damaged boxes, and Choose transport options that reduce exposure to rain and high humidity, such as covered docks and climate-controlled linehaul for medical drugs.
High-value medical drugs Benefit from Specialized cargo insurance that covers temperature excursions, breakage, and theft. Consult an insurer familiar with pharmaceutical goods, Declare the full replacement value, and retain temperature and handling records so claims can be processed efficiently if something goes wrong.
Required documentation includes a commercial invoice, packing list, and any necessary certificates such as a Certificate of Analysis or a Certificate of Free Sale, as well as compliance with U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) regulations.
Yes, pharmaceuticals typically require temperature control and monitoring throughout the air shipment to ensure product integrity. Additionally, they must be packed in compliance with IATA regulations for dangerous goods if applicable.
